does anyone have any tips?  my colt m16 armorers manual is useless here
5/2/2003 2:23:43 AM EDT
[#1]
Straight job of holding the FA unit in place while you tap the pin in.  I start the pin into the hole from the bottom of the reciever, so the rear sight assy doesn't get in the way, and get the pin part way in before I assemble the FA and spring into the hole. Then just hold the assy in place til you get the pin tapped in far enough to retain it w/o having to hold it. I use a very small head hammer, initially, so I can tap the pin directly w/o using a punch.  Once the pin is in far enough to retain the assy, I'll go to a punch and regular hammer to finish the job.  Not hard if you're careful[:D]

Luckily ProfGab101 was in chat and he gave me some good tips for installing it which took me about 1 minute to install the thing.  I used an undersized punch and a push pin holder as well as a small hammer for this job.  I pushed the FA in til about 1/2" was sticking out then placed the undersized punch through the hole for the push pin.  I used the pin hilder to hold the pushpin and i tapped it in through the top while the punch was still in place.  When the pushpin holder almost made contact with the reciever i removed it and finished off tapping the pin with a punch.  IT works as it was intended to
